Both are forms of energy. Potential energy is the available energy that could be used and Kinetic energy is the energy actually being used. Think of Potential energy as being a high cliff with water on top. The higher the cliff the more energy available. If no water is falling though, there is noting being used, But the potential for falling water is still there. Kinetic energy is the water that actually falls.
The same as any other falling object. When it is at the top, it has gravitational potential energy; as it falls, that's converted to kinetic energy.

when the water is flowing over the the dam with high velocity, it acquires great kinetic energy, when this water is used to turn the turbines, this kinetic energy will be converted into electrical energy. so, when the water flows over the dam, hydroelectricity is produced.
The potential energy of the falling down water transfers to kinetic energy. The kinetic energy turns turbines that are connected to electric generators where the kinetic energy transfers into electric energy.
